a change in color can indicate a chemical reaction. true false

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

A change in color is one of the common signs of a chemical reaction. For example, when iron rusts (a chemical reaction), it changes from a metallic color to a reddish - brown color. Another example is the reaction between phenolphthalein (an indicator) and a base. Phenolphthalein is colorless in an acidic or neutral solution but turns pink in a basic solution.

Answer:

True
